# Firmware Update Channel — Contacts

Changes to the Lanternfall firmware update channel require sign-off from the Embedded Platform group before merge. Reviewers should confirm that staged rollouts target the `beta-ring` first and that rollback manifests are attached to every release PR. Questions about signing keys or channel promotion policy go to the channel stewards, currently rotating weekly. Before approving anything touching the promotion pipeline, check with them at the address below.

escalation mailbox, bafog-fafog: ulador@paliqlabs.internal

Welcome, plugin folks! Quick heads-up: the Glimmerhawk sandbox sometimes has flaky DNS resolution — lookups for the resolver pool in our Tovren region occasionally time out on first try. If your plugin sees intermittent connection failures, just retry once with a short backoff; don't cache negative results. While we chase the root cause, you can bypass DNS entirely for metadata checks by connecting straight to the staging database below.

replica DSN, kajep-yahag: mssql://praok_svc:iF@db-8d68.plorvaio.local:5432/eliion

Quick note on websocket compression in Meshpipe: we run permessage-deflate on the chat channels but keep telemetry streams uncompressed. Why? Compression saves ~60% bandwidth but the context windows eat memory fast — about 300KB per connection at our settings. Past 50k connections that's real money. If you're tempted to flip it on everywhere, benchmark on the Harstow staging cluster first. The full tradeoff analysis and tuning history live on the internal page linked below.

wiki page, tahaf-tajog: https://jira.ordindyn.corp/pipeline

## Clock Skew on Build Agents

Welcome to the Lattirun build team. Our agents in the Verholt cluster occasionally drift out of sync, which causes signed artifacts to be rejected by the Prennix validator. Before investigating a failed build, always compare the agent's clock against the Prennix time endpoint; a skew above 300ms is actionable. To query the endpoint, authenticate with the internal time-audit key. The current key is shown below.

API key for fahif-bahop: vxb23-B1zKyQaAnaG4Gma9WuizPfB